White River Junction, located in Hartford, Vermont, is a small community with a rich history and vibrant cultural scene. Originally a major railroad hub, the area has transformed into a cultural center with a mix of local businesses and artistic venues. Main Street is the heart of downtown, featuring diverse dining options like Tuckerbox and Big Fatty’s BBQ, as well as unique shops such as Revolution and Post. The local food scene is complemented by River Roost Brewery and Putnam’s Vine/Yard, a wine bar and plant shop. The artistic community thrives with venues like the Tip Top Media and Arts Building and Long River Gallery, and hosts events such as the White River Indie Film Festival. The White River Junction Historic District showcases 19th-century Queen Anne, Colonial Revival, and Italianate Revival homes, while other areas offer ranch-style, Cape Cod-style, and New Englander-style houses. Green spaces like Lyman Point Park provide recreational opportunities with boating, fishing, and summer concerts, while Quechee Gorge State Park, located less than 7 miles away, offers extensive nature trails. The historic White River Junction train station provides daily Amtrak service, and Advance Transit offers free bus service. The community is also conveniently located near Dartmouth Hitchcock Medical Center and the White River Junction VA Medical Center.
